DSK1 and DSK2 Quick Setup

The DSK1 and DSK2 keyers can be used for Linear or Luma keying but cannot be set up for Chroma keying. This is
because only Key1 and Key2 are designed for Chroma key use.
For this example we will be supplying the SE-1200 MU with a background feed on button 5. Select a CG-350
overlay input using button 4 on the Aux Bus row
Step 1: Choose the Keyer channel that you want to
use. In our example, click the DSK 1 button on the
AUX BUSES panel.
Step 2: Choose the type of Keyer you want to use.
Step 3: In our example, click the Lin button on the
KEYER CONTROLS panel.
Note:
If DSK only has one source for key source, press Self
button
If DSK have two sources for Fill source & Key source,
press Split button.
Step 4: Click Split button (backlit green), select key
source on AUX BUS Row.
Step 5: Click Split button again (backlit orange),
select Fill source on AUX BUS Row.
Step 6: Turn the keying effect on. Click the On
button so it is backlit green.
In our example, you will now see the selected
source button 4, on the Aux Bus Row change
so it is now backlit Red.
Step 7: Make some adjustments to the Luma key.
Click the Keyer button on the MENU SELECT panel
to open the Screen Menu as shown on the left.
Lift: LUMA Key lightness, please set 0.
Gain: LUMA Key darkness, please set 1
Opacity: LUMA Key transparency, please set 100
Invert: LUMA Key invert, please set Off
